KFRC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2022 in Review

203 of the 5,936 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Kforce (KFRC) for Q2 2022, worth a combined $1.14B — down 16% from $1.35B a quarter earlier.

Fund positioning in KFRC was balanced in Q2 2022: 23 funds opened new positions, 23 closed out, 82 added to existing stakes and 69 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Goldman Sachs, adding an estimated $15.5M. The largest seller was Lord, Abbett & Co, cutting an estimated $23.3M.
